1. Color Consistency

Color consistency in wood staining products directly impacts the final aesthetic outcome of a project. A lack of consistency in reddish-brown wood stains, such as those sold at home improvement retailers, can lead to uneven coloration across a surface, resulting in a visually unappealing and unprofessional finish. This inconsistency may manifest as variations in the depth of color, streaking, or blotchiness, particularly when applied to different pieces of wood within the same project.

Several factors contribute to these potential color inconsistencies. The wood species itself influences the absorption rate of the stain, with porous woods like pine often requiring a pre-stain conditioner to ensure even color uptake. Additionally, variations in the manufacturing batch of the stain can introduce subtle differences in pigment concentration or formulation, leading to discrepancies in the final color. Application techniques also play a crucial role. Uneven application, such as applying too much stain in one area and too little in another, exacerbates any inherent inconsistencies in the product’s color. A real-world example is staining a set of cabinet doors with stain from a single can; if the stain is not thoroughly mixed or if the application is uneven, the doors may exhibit noticeable color variations.

Achieving color consistency requires careful attention to detail throughout the staining process. Thorough mixing of the stain before and during application is essential to ensure uniform pigment distribution. Proper wood preparation, including sanding and the application of a pre-stain conditioner where appropriate, helps create a more uniform surface for stain absorption. Furthermore, consistent application techniques, such as using a high-quality brush or applicator and applying even coats, minimize the risk of color variations. Understanding these factors and implementing best practices is crucial for obtaining a consistent and aesthetically pleasing finish with any reddish-brown wood stain.

2. Wood Preparation

Wood preparation directly influences the outcome of applying reddish-brown stain to a wooden surface. Proper preparation is a critical antecedent to achieving a uniform and aesthetically pleasing finish. Failure to adequately prepare the wood results in uneven stain absorption, leading to blotchiness and a compromised appearance. For example, if a pine board intended for staining receives insufficient sanding, the stain will penetrate the softer parts of the wood more readily than the harder areas, resulting in an inconsistent color distribution. The type of wood also dictates the necessary preparatory steps. Porous woods, such as pine, often benefit from a pre-stain wood conditioner, which minimizes blotching by creating a more uniform surface for stain absorption. Without this step, the final color may appear uneven and detract from the intended aesthetic.

The practical significance of wood preparation extends beyond purely aesthetic considerations. Proper sanding removes imperfections, such as scratches or old finishes, which would otherwise be accentuated by the stain. Cleaning the wood to remove dust, grease, or other contaminants ensures proper adhesion of the stain and prevents interference with the coloring process. Consider the scenario of refinishing an old table; if the existing finish is not completely removed and the surface is not thoroughly cleaned, the stain will not penetrate evenly, resulting in a patchy and unattractive result. Furthermore, neglecting to address defects like nail holes or gouges before staining will highlight these imperfections, diminishing the overall quality of the finished piece.

In summary, thorough wood preparation is an indispensable component of achieving a professional and lasting finish with reddish-brown stains. Addressing surface imperfections, ensuring cleanliness, and applying appropriate pre-stain treatments are all vital steps. Overlooking these preparatory measures invariably leads to compromised aesthetic results and a reduced lifespan for the stained wood surface. Understanding the connection between preparation and outcome empowers users to make informed decisions and achieve optimal results in their wood finishing projects.

3. Application Method

The method employed for applying a reddish-brown stain significantly impacts the final appearance and longevity of the finish. Selection of the appropriate technique, coupled with careful execution, is crucial for achieving the desired aesthetic and ensuring optimal stain penetration and adherence. Improper application techniques can lead to uneven color distribution, streaking, and a compromised final result.

  • Brush Application

    Brush application involves using a brush to apply the stain to the wood surface. The choice of brush natural bristle for oil-based stains and synthetic for water-based is critical. Using the incorrect brush type leads to uneven application and potential brush stroke marks. For example, applying the reddish-brown stain with a low-quality brush will likely result in visible brush strokes and an inconsistent color. Proper technique includes applying the stain in the direction of the wood grain and avoiding excessive build-up. Wipe off the excess stain.

  • Rag Application

    Rag application involves applying the stain with a lint-free cloth or rag. This method is particularly useful for achieving a more controlled and subtle color. A common mistake is using a rag that leaves fibers on the wood surface, resulting in an uneven texture and compromised aesthetic. For instance, a well-executed rag application of the reddish-brown stain results in a uniform color and allows for precise control over the intensity of the stain.

  • Spray Application

    Spray application utilizes a sprayer, either airless or HVLP (High Volume Low Pressure), to apply the stain. This method is suitable for large or intricate surfaces, providing a consistent and even coat. However, proper equipment settings and technique are essential to prevent runs, drips, and overspray. Spraying this stain onto a detailed molding requires precise nozzle control and consistent distance to avoid pooling and uneven coverage. If overspray does occur, wipe off immediately.

  • Wiping Technique

    Regardless of the initial application method (brush, rag, or spray), the wiping technique is crucial for achieving a uniform color and removing excess stain. Failing to properly wipe off excess stain results in a dark and uneven finish. For example, if after brushing the reddish-brown stain, the surface is not wiped thoroughly, the final color will be much darker and may obscure the wood grain. The direction of wiping should generally follow the grain of the wood.

The success of achieving the desired outcome with a reddish-brown stain hinges significantly on the chosen application method and the skill with which it is executed. Each method possesses its advantages and disadvantages, requiring careful consideration of the project’s specific needs and the user’s experience level to ensure a professional-looking and long-lasting finish. Proper technique, regardless of the method selected, is paramount to avoiding common pitfalls and maximizing the stain’s aesthetic potential.

4. Drying Time

The drying time of reddish-brown stains is a critical parameter affecting project timelines and the overall quality of the finished wood surface. This timeframe, during which the stain’s solvents evaporate and the pigments bind to the wood fibers, is contingent upon multiple factors. Environmental conditions, such as ambient temperature and humidity levels, exert a direct influence. Higher temperatures typically accelerate the evaporation process, reducing the drying time, while elevated humidity levels can impede evaporation, prolonging the period required for the stain to fully cure. The type of stain formulation, whether oil-based or water-based, also plays a significant role. Oil-based stains generally require longer drying times compared to their water-based counterparts, owing to the slower evaporation rate of the oil-based solvents.

The practical consequences of disregarding recommended drying times are substantial. Applying a topcoat, such as varnish or polyurethane, before the stain has fully dried can trap solvents beneath the surface, leading to blistering, clouding, or adhesion failures in the subsequent finish layers. These defects compromise the aesthetic appearance and protective properties of the final coating. A real-world example is finishing a mahogany-stained tabletop, where premature application of polyurethane results in a hazy, uneven surface requiring complete stripping and reapplication. Furthermore, inadequate drying can result in the stain remaining tacky, attracting dust and debris that become embedded in the finish, creating an undesirable texture and appearance.

In summary, adhering to the manufacturer’s specified drying time for reddish-brown stains is essential for achieving optimal results. Failure to do so can lead to a range of problems, from cosmetic imperfections to compromised structural integrity of the finish. Careful monitoring of environmental conditions and selecting appropriate drying times based on the stain formulation are critical for ensuring a durable, aesthetically pleasing, and long-lasting wood finish.

5. Topcoat Compatibility

The selection of a compatible topcoat is critical to the successful application and longevity of reddish-brown wood stains. The interaction between the stain and the topcoat directly influences the final appearance, durability, and protective qualities of the finished wood surface. Incompatibility can manifest as adhesion failures, discoloration, or other undesirable effects, undermining the overall quality of the project.

  • Solvent-Based vs. Water-Based Compatibility

    A primary consideration is the solvent base of both the stain and the topcoat. Generally, oil-based reddish-brown stains are best paired with oil-based topcoats, such as polyurethane or varnish. Conversely, water-based stains are designed for use with water-based topcoats, like water-based polyurethane or acrylic finishes. Mixing solvent bases can lead to issues like lifting, where the topcoat dissolves the stain, or poor adhesion, where the topcoat fails to bond properly. For example, applying a water-based polyurethane over an oil-based stain before it is fully cured often results in a cloudy or uneven finish.

  • Adhesion Properties

    The ability of the topcoat to adhere properly to the stained surface is paramount. Some topcoats may not bond effectively with certain types of stains, leading to peeling, chipping, or cracking over time. Surface preparation, including proper sanding and cleaning, plays a significant role in promoting adhesion. A test patch is always advisable to ensure compatibility before applying the topcoat to the entire project. Failing to test for adhesion can result in significant rework, requiring the complete removal of both the topcoat and the stain.

  • Chemical Reactivity

    Chemical reactions between the stain and the topcoat can lead to discoloration or other undesirable effects. Some stains contain pigments or dyes that react negatively with certain topcoat formulations, causing yellowing, fading, or a change in color. For instance, a reddish-brown stain containing certain aniline dyes may yellow significantly when coated with a specific type of lacquer. Again, testing a small, inconspicuous area is crucial to identify potential chemical incompatibilities before applying the topcoat to the entire surface.

  • Flexibility and Durability

    The flexibility and durability of the topcoat must be appropriate for the intended use of the stained wood surface. For high-traffic areas, such as floors or tabletops, a durable and abrasion-resistant topcoat is essential. For more decorative applications, a less robust topcoat may suffice. Selecting a topcoat that is too rigid for a flexible wood substrate can result in cracking or crazing as the wood expands and contracts with changes in temperature and humidity. Choosing a topcoat specifically formulated for the intended application ensures optimal protection and longevity of the finish.

In conclusion, ensuring compatibility between the stain and topcoat is a fundamental aspect of wood finishing. Selecting compatible products based on their solvent base, adhesion properties, chemical reactivity, flexibility, and durability guarantees a professional and long-lasting finish, whether using reddish-brown stains purchased from home improvement retailers or other sources. Prioritizing compatibility minimizes the risk of costly errors and maximizes the aesthetic and protective benefits of the wood finishing process.

6. Durability

The durability of a wood finish achieved using reddish-brown stains from home improvement retailers is directly contingent on several interconnected factors. While the stain itself primarily imparts color, its contribution to the overall protective qualities of the finished wood is indirect. The stain’s primary role is aesthetic; however, its proper application serves as a foundation for subsequent protective coatings. The inherent characteristics of the wood species, the quality of the stain formulation, the preparation of the substrate, the application technique, and the selection of a compatible and robust topcoat collectively determine the resilience of the final finish. For instance, a softwood like pine, stained with a readily available reddish-brown product and protected with multiple coats of high-quality polyurethane, exhibits significantly greater resistance to abrasion, moisture, and UV exposure than a similarly stained surface lacking a protective topcoat.

The connection between durability and reddish-brown wood stains becomes especially apparent in high-use applications. Consider the case of wooden furniture refinished with the intent of daily use. A properly applied stain enhances the aesthetic appeal, but without a durable topcoat, the stained surface is vulnerable to scratches, water rings, and fading from sunlight. This necessitates the application of a protective layer, typically a varnish, lacquer, or polyurethane, chosen for its resistance to wear, moisture, and chemical damage. The stain, in this context, acts as an intermediary layer, providing color and accentuating the wood grain, while the topcoat bears the responsibility of safeguarding the underlying wood and stain from environmental stressors. Maintenance also plays a crucial role; regular cleaning and periodic reapplication of the topcoat can significantly extend the lifespan of the finished surface, ensuring its continued aesthetic appeal and structural integrity.

In summary, the durability of a wood finish incorporating reddish-brown stains found in home improvement stores is not solely a property of the stain itself but rather a result of a comprehensive finishing system. The stain serves to enhance the wood’s appearance, but the longevity and resilience of the finish are primarily determined by the preparation, application, and type of protective topcoat applied. Understanding this interplay is essential for achieving a durable and aesthetically pleasing wood finish that withstands the rigors of everyday use. Challenges arise when users prioritize aesthetics over proper preparation and protection, resulting in finishes that are visually appealing but lack the necessary durability for long-term use. A holistic approach, emphasizing both aesthetics and protection, is crucial for realizing a successful and enduring wood finishing project.

Tips for Achieving Optimal Results with Reddish-Brown Wood Stains

This section provides guidance on maximizing the aesthetic and protective qualities of wood finishes achieved with reddish-brown stains. Adherence to these practices enhances the final appearance and longevity of stained wood surfaces.

Tip 1: Prioritize Surface Preparation: Thorough sanding is paramount. Begin with coarser grits and progressively refine to finer grits for a smooth, uniform surface. This ensures consistent stain absorption and prevents uneven coloration. For porous woods, the application of a pre-stain wood conditioner is strongly advised to minimize blotching.

Tip 2: Conduct a Test Application: Before staining the entire project, apply the reddish-brown stain to an inconspicuous area or a scrap piece of the same wood species. This test reveals the final color and allows for adjustments to the staining process. It confirms compatibility with chosen topcoats.

Tip 3: Maintain Consistent Application Technique: Whether brushing, ragging, or spraying, employ a consistent technique throughout the staining process. Apply thin, even coats to prevent pooling and uneven color distribution. Overlapping strokes should be minimized to avoid darker areas.

Tip 4: Control Drying Time: Adhere to the manufacturer’s recommended drying times. Premature application of a topcoat can trap solvents, leading to blistering, clouding, or adhesion failures. Ensure adequate ventilation to promote efficient drying.

Tip 5: Wipe Off Excess Stain Thoroughly: After applying the stain, promptly wipe off any excess with a clean, lint-free cloth. Wipe in the direction of the wood grain to prevent streaking. This step is crucial for achieving a uniform color and revealing the wood’s natural grain pattern.

Tip 6: Select a Compatible Topcoat: The choice of topcoat directly impacts the durability and appearance of the finished surface. Oil-based stains are typically compatible with oil-based topcoats, while water-based stains require water-based topcoats. Test the compatibility of the stain and topcoat before full application to avert negative reactions. Consider a durable topcoat for high traffic area.

Tip 7: Employ Proper Safety Precautions: Always wear appropriate protective gear, including gloves, eye protection, and a respirator, when working with wood stains and finishes. Work in a well-ventilated area to minimize exposure to harmful fumes. Dispose of used rags and applicators properly to prevent fire hazards.

Following these guidelines promotes successful results with reddish-brown stains, resulting in aesthetically pleasing, durable wood finishes that enhance the inherent beauty of the wood.
